Ventilation, heat insulation and waterproof roof system and method
The invention relates to the related technical field of ventilation, heat insulation and waterproof roofing, in particular to a ventilation, heat insulation and waterproof roofing system and a ventilation, heat insulation and waterproof roofing method, and provides a more efficient and reliable ventilation, heat insulation and waterproof roofing system. The heat insulation, waterproof and ventilation performance of the roof system is ensured to reach the optimal state, so that the temperature fluctuation in a building is effectively reduced, the energy consumption is reduced, the living or using comfort is improved, and by adopting advanced materials and construction technologies, the roof system is simpler and more convenient to maintain and overhaul in the later period, and the cost is reduced. The long-term use cost of the building is reduced, meanwhile, the service life of the roof system is prolonged, the roof system can be suitable for different types of buildings including flat roof and pitched roof roofs, and various building styles and use requirements are met.
